مجموعة "الجميع" غير قادرة على رؤية القوالب الخاصة

تم العثور على خطأ أثناء اختبار إضافة القوالب. إصدار Discourse 3.2.0.beta1-dev (24d46fd981)، التزام القوالب 146dc201. (أرى الآن أن هناك إصدارًا جديدًا قبل ثماني ساعات، ولكن نظرًا لأن الالتزام لا يذكر هذا الخطأ على وجه التحديد، فأنا أخاطر بافتراض أنه لم يتم إصلاحه. يرجى تصحيحي إذا كنت مخطئًا.)

  1. قم بتعيين مستخدم واحد كعضو عادي، ولكن ليس عضوًا في أي مجموعة.

  2. تم تمكين القوالب الخاصة وإنشاء علامة template. سمح لـ everyone باستخدام القوالب الخاصة.

  3. قام المستخدم المذكور أعلاه بإنشاء رسالة خاصة لنفسه ووضع علامة عليها كقالب، ولكن لم يتمكن من رؤيتها كخيار للاختيار عند إنشاء موضوع جديد.

تمكنت، بصفتي عضوًا في فريق العمل، من إنشاء رسالة خاصة خاصة بي ووضع علامة عليها كقالب ورؤية كليهما، بنفس الإعدادات.

ثم قمت بتعيين المستخدم التجريبي إلى مجموعة ونقلت الإذن الخاص بالمجموعة تحديدًا من everyone إلى تلك المجموعة فقط، وبعد ذلك تمكن المستخدم من رؤية القالب الخاص به.

إعجاب واحد (1)

ماذا لو قمت بتعيين الأذونات لـ @trust_level_0 بدلاً من ذلك؟ هل يعمل حينها؟

إعجاب واحد (1)

نعم، يبدو أن trust_level_0 يعمل. حل بديل جيد، إذا لم يخططوا لإصلاح everyone.

إعجاب واحد (1)

‘الجميع’ هي في الواقع مجموعة زائفة تتضمن المجهول، وربما لا ينبغي تضمينها كمجموعة متاحة لتعيينها هنا. :thinking:

أعتقد أن تعيين TL0 سيكون هو الشيء الصحيح لفعله. :+1:

سأرى ما إذا كان بإمكاننا العثور على شخص لإلقاء نظرة.

3 إعجابات

أنا بخير مع هذا المنطق. أردت فقط الإبلاغ عنه لأنه كان شيئًا لاحظته. :ابتسامة:

إعجاب واحد (1)